Fix bug 58703: Revert trap behavior for the sake of autoconf-generated configure scripts. The problem here is that bash -c 'trap 0' works, but sh -c 'trap 0' doesn't work because the bash developers are trying to adhere to POSIX in that case. Since all the configure scripts are #!/bin/sh, this breaks them... That's bad news and will need some time to fix, so it's easier to fix here for the moment
